To really lean into the idea, some fruits even look like more traditional desserts, like Saturn peaches.
Normally when we think of peaches, we picture an orange fuzzy heart-shaped sphere, about the size of a tennis ball.

That’s not the case for Saturn peaches.
This type of peach actually looks like a donut, which is why they’re also called “donut peaches.”

These aren’t genetically modified in any way, either. Their shape is au natural, well, with some hybridized tweaks made by creator Jerry Frecon.
Fun fact: this variety was actually brought straight from China over a century ago. Jerry and colleague Dr. Fred Hough loved them, but wanted to create a hardier frost-resistant trees that produced tastier and larger fruit.
The peaches are flat in shape with a pretty orange and yellow color, and their high sugar content makes them super sweet.

Because of their flat shape and “dimpled” center, they’re actually a lot easier and less messy to eat than regular peaches.
